A high-pitched squealing noise while driving is one of the most common—and most misunderstood—vehicle complaints. Because the car may otherwise feel normal, the sound often creates uncertainty rather than immediate alarm.
Squeals are typically caused by friction, vibration, or slipping components, and the pitch of the noise can provide important clues about where the problem originates.
The challenge is that several different systems can produce a similar sound, ranging from minor maintenance issues to problems that affect safety if ignored. Understanding when a squeal is harmless and when it signals a developing failure requires looking at how and when the noise appears.
The sections below outline the most frequent causes of high-pitched squealing while driving, explain how professionals narrow down the source without guesswork, and clarify when continued driving is reasonable versus when inspection should happen immediately.

First Question I Always Ask: When Does the Squeal Happen?
Before touching a wrench or visiting a shop, I pay attention to patterns. This alone narrows the problem dramatically.
I ask myself:
- Does it happen all the time or only at certain speeds?
- Does it change when I brake?
- Does it disappear when I turn?
- Is it worse when the car is cold or warm?
- Does engine speed affect it, or only vehicle speed?
These answers tell me whether the sound is likely coming from the brakes, belts, wheels, or something else entirely.
Brake-Related Squealing: The Most Common Cause
In my experience, brakes are the number one source of high-pitched squeals.
Why brakes squeal
Brake pads are designed to press against metal rotors. As pads wear down, they can vibrate or expose wear indicators that intentionally make noise to alert you.
Common signs:
- squeal appears at low speeds
- sound gets louder when braking lightly
- noise may disappear under hard braking
- squeal often comes and goes
Some pads squeal even when they’re not worn out, especially if they’re cold, dusty, or made of harder material.
When it’s a warning
If the squeal:
- gets louder over time
- turns into grinding
- comes with vibration through the pedal
That’s no longer just noise — that’s wear reaching its limit.
Belt Squeal From the Engine Area
Another frequent cause is a slipping belt under the hood.
Belts spin accessories like the alternator and power steering. When they wear, glaze over, or lose tension, they can squeal sharply.
Clues that point to belts:
- noise changes with engine speed
- squeal is loudest during acceleration
- sound is strongest right after starting the car
- noise disappears once the engine warms up
I’ve had belt squeals that sounded dramatic but were fixed with a simple replacement or tension adjustment.
Wheel Bearings and Rotating Components
If the squeal changes with speed but not engine RPM, I start thinking about the wheels.
Possible causes include:
- worn wheel bearings
- brake dust shields touching rotors
- debris stuck near the brakes
- uneven tire wear
Wheel-related squeals often:
- increase as speed increases
- change pitch during turns
- disappear briefly on smooth roads
This type of noise shouldn’t be ignored for too long, especially if it changes when turning — that’s often a sign of bearing wear.
Suspension and Steering Components
High-pitched squeals don’t always come from spinning parts. Sometimes they come from movement under load.
Worn bushings, dry joints, or stressed components can squeal when the car moves, especially:
- when going over bumps
- during turns
- while entering driveways
- when weight shifts
These noises can sound like rubber rubbing or metal squeaking. While not always urgent, they often signal aging parts that will eventually affect handling.
High-Pitched Squeal From the Transmission Area
This one is less common, but more serious.
Some transmission-related noises produce:
- a whining or squealing sound
- noise that increases with speed
- sound present even when coasting
Low fluid levels or internal wear can cause this. If the squeal is paired with hesitation, rough shifting, or warning lights, I don’t keep driving without inspection.
Exhaust and Heat Shield Issues
Thin metal vibrates easily, and exhaust systems are full of thin metal.
Loose heat shields, clamps, or exhaust components can produce:
- high-pitched rattling or squealing
- noise that appears at specific speeds
- sound that disappears above or below a certain RPM
These noises often echo, making them sound worse than they are. Still, loose exhaust parts should be secured to prevent further damage.
Tire-Related Squeals
Tires can squeal even when nothing is broken.
Common situations include:
- aggressive acceleration
- sharp turns
- uneven tire wear
- misalignment
However, constant squealing while driving straight usually points to alignment issues or worn suspension parts causing uneven contact with the road.
Cold Weather vs Warm Weather Noises
Temperature plays a bigger role than most people realize.
Cold weather can:
- stiffen rubber
- harden brake pads
- reduce belt flexibility
That’s why some squeals only appear on cold mornings and disappear once everything warms up. These aren’t always emergencies, but they’re worth monitoring.
How I Narrow the Problem Down Step by Step
When I hear a squeal, I follow a simple process instead of guessing.
- Listen carefully
Note pitch, duration, and conditions. - Test braking
Does the sound change when braking lightly or firmly? - Test engine speed
Rev the engine while parked. If the noise appears, it’s engine-related. - Change speed
Does the pitch rise with speed or stay constant? - Turn the wheel
Turning often reveals bearing or suspension issues. - Visual inspection
Look for worn belts, uneven tires, or loose components.
This approach saves time and avoids replacing parts unnecessarily.
Is It Safe to Keep Driving?
This depends entirely on the source.
Generally:
- light brake squeal is usually safe short-term
- belt squeal should be addressed soon
- wheel bearing noise should not be ignored
- transmission squeal needs immediate attention
If the noise:
- suddenly gets louder
- is paired with warning lights
- affects steering or braking
- comes with burning smells
I stop driving and get it checked.
